What is Altron COGS-to-Revenue?

Altron's Cost of Goods Sold for the six months ended in Feb. 2024 was R3,217 Mil. Its Revenue for the six months ended in Feb. 2024 was R3,929 Mil.

Altron's COGS to Revenue for the six months ended in Feb. 2024 was 0.82.

Cost of Goods Sold is directly linked to profitability of the company through Gross Margin. Altron's Gross Margin % for the six months ended in Feb. 2024 was 18.12%.

Altron  (JSE:AEL) COGS-to-Revenue Explanation

Cost of Goods Sold is directly linked to profitability of the company through Gross Margin.

Altron's Gross Margin % for the six months ended in Feb. 2024 is calculated as:

Gross Margin %=1 - COGS to Revenue
=1 - Cost of Goods Sold / Revenue
=1 - 3217 / 3929
=18.12 %

A company that has a moat can usually maintain or even expand their Gross Margin. A company can increase its Gross Margin in two ways. It can increase the prices of the goods it sells and keeps its Cost of Goods Sold unchanged. Or it can keep the sales price unchanged and squeeze its suppliers to reduce the Cost of Goods Sold. Warren Buffett believes businesses with the power to raise prices have moats.

Altron Ltd provides integrated ICT solutions to businesses, governments, and consumers. Its segments are Digital Transformation, Managed Services, and Own Platforms. It has a direct presence in South Africa, the rest of Africa, Europe, the Middle East, and Australia. Most of the group's revenue is derived from the local market in South Africa.
